Enhancing Learning with Audio
Hearing- a physiological process of sound waves entering the outer ear,
transmitted to the eardrum, converted into vibrations in the middle ear,
and changed in the inner ear into electrical impulses that travel to the
brain.
Listening- a psychological process; awareness and attention to sounds
or speech patterns, identification and recognition of auditory signals, and
ends in comprehension.
